Fix embed logo links
This commit is contained in:
parent
d7d8d3516e
commit
bfb8f0dd28
2 changed files with 8 additions and 4 deletions
|
@ -4,7 +4,6 @@ import Button from 'component/button';
|
||||||
import FilePrice from 'component/filePrice';
|
import FilePrice from 'component/filePrice';
|
||||||
import { formatLbryUrlForWeb } from 'util/url';
|
import { formatLbryUrlForWeb } from 'util/url';
|
||||||
import { withRouter } from 'react-router';
|
import { withRouter } from 'react-router';
|
||||||
import { URL } from 'config';
|
|
||||||
import Logo from 'component/logo';
|
import Logo from 'component/logo';
|
||||||
|
|
||||||
type Props = {
|
type Props = {
|
||||||
|
@ -24,7 +23,7 @@ function FileViewerEmbeddedTitle(props: Props) {
|
||||||
}
|
}
|
||||||
|
|
||||||
const contentLinkProps = isInApp ? { navigate: contentLink } : { href: contentLink };
|
const contentLinkProps = isInApp ? { navigate: contentLink } : { href: contentLink };
|
||||||
const lbryLinkProps = isInApp ? { navigate: '/' } : { href: URL };
|
const odyseeLinkProps = isInApp ? { navigate: '/' } : { href: '/' };
|
||||||
|
|
||||||
return (
|
return (
|
||||||
<div className="file-viewer__embedded-header">
|
<div className="file-viewer__embedded-header">
|
||||||
|
@ -44,7 +43,12 @@ function FileViewerEmbeddedTitle(props: Props) {
|
||||||
)}
|
)}
|
||||||
|
|
||||||
<div className="file-viewer__embedded-info">
|
<div className="file-viewer__embedded-info">
|
||||||
<Button className="file-viewer__overlay-logo" disabled={preferEmbed} aria-label={__('Home')} {...lbryLinkProps}>
|
<Button
|
||||||
|
className="file-viewer__overlay-logo"
|
||||||
|
disabled={preferEmbed}
|
||||||
|
aria-label={__('Home')}
|
||||||
|
{...odyseeLinkProps}
|
||||||
|
>
|
||||||
<Logo type={'embed'} />
|
<Logo type={'embed'} />
|
||||||
</Button>
|
</Button>
|
||||||
{isInApp && <FilePrice uri={uri} />}
|
{isInApp && <FilePrice uri={uri} />}
|
||||||
|
|
|
@ -44,7 +44,7 @@ function FileViewerEmbeddedEnded(props: Props) {
|
||||||
return (
|
return (
|
||||||
<div className="file-viewer__overlay">
|
<div className="file-viewer__overlay">
|
||||||
<div className="file-viewer__overlay-secondary">
|
<div className="file-viewer__overlay-secondary">
|
||||||
<Button className="file-viewer__overlay-logo" href={URL} disabled={preferEmbed}>
|
<Button className="file-viewer__overlay-logo" href="/" disabled={preferEmbed}>
|
||||||
<Logo type={'embed'} />
|
<Logo type={'embed'} />
|
||||||
</Button>
|
</Button>
|
||||||
</div>
|
</div>
|
||||||
|
|
Loading…
Reference in a new issue